The first step in how to cut down a tree leaning toward the house is to make a notch cut on the side you … WebMar 17, 2024 · Continue on to look for other signs of a dead tree, including: Decay-producing fungi, such as mushrooms, growing at the base of the trunk. Chipped or peeling bark and cracks in the trunk. Cavities in the trunk or large scaffold branches. Dead or hanging branches in the upper crown. Generally, trees that lean naturally over time are not a … WebJun 11, 2024 · The tree is hollow. A tree with a hollow trunk has been seriously compromised and is a hazard. If a third of the tree is rotted or hollow inside, it needs to be removed. The tree is suddenly leaning. All leaning trees aren’t necessarily dangerous, but a tree that suddenly leans to one side may have structural problems.
